About the Show

1776 The Musical
July 2, 3, 4, 5, 2026

What better time to stage 1776 than during the 250th anniversary of our country? This unconventional Broadway hit brings the founding of America to life, revealing the real people behind the legends — proud, uncertain, irritable, funny, and ultimately noble. Set in the summer of 1776, the story follows John Adams, Benjamin Franklin, and Thomas Jefferson as they struggle to convince the Continental Congress to declare independence from Britain. With sharp wit, a powerful score, and timeless relevance, 1776 reminds us that history was made not by perfect heroes, but by passionate individuals determined to do what was right for a fledgling nation.
